  17. I have only seen private tours mentioned twice at M&Gs. Once the promoter was actively and openly connecting funds while the captain and staff were present and in the other instance it low key. If it is done discretely there should be no problem. I suggest that an organizer publish on the Cruise Critic roll call details of what is being proposed then have a meeting after the M&G to collect money and talk to anyone else that may be interested. It can even be at the same venue. This shouldn't be done while the Princess staff is talking and answering questions but as they are leaving or have left. If courtesy and common sense are used there should be no problem. I'm sure others have had or know of other experiences on this topic.

  19. I have only been on 1 Princess cruise that served cookies, etc. and that was on the Emerald Princess in March. I suggest you e-mail Heather and ask her to contact the Loyalty Ambassador ("LA") for that sailing. There seems to be a trend that the LAs are assisting with inviting the crew, providing refreshments, and acquiring any special equipment that might be needed like a microphone. I don't think this is fleetwide yet but worth an e-mail to Heather.
